Economy & Jobs

County Center residents earn a median household income of $180,825 , which is 141%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$59,778. The unemployment rate stands at 3.8% (6% above the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 1.8%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 10,632 business establishments, including 828 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in County Center is $550,000 , 95% above the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$994,825. Median rent is $1,891/month, with 24.6%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 101.1 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 2004.

Safety & Crime

County Center reports 0 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 100%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 0/100K.

Education

53.8% of adults in County Center hold a bachelor's degree or higher (60% above the national average). 93.0%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.0/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

County Center has an average annual temperature of 56°F (13°C). Winters average 33°F in January while summers reach 78°F in July. The area gets 297 sunny days per year.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 35.
